Edgar Douglas Adrian, 1st Baron Adrian: Facts & Related Content
Facts
Born | November 30, 1889 • London • England |
---|---|
Died | August 4, 1977 (aged 87) • London • England |
Title / Office | baron (1955) |
Awards And Honors | Nobel Prize (1932) |
Subjects Of Study | brain • nerve impulse • sense organ |
